OUTSTANDING FIELD PERFORMANCE CONFIRMS THE STRENGTH OF LOHMANN LSL-LITE

Lohmann Genetics
Field results from Norway clearly demonstrate the outstanding performance and reliability of LOHMANN LSL-LITE under commercial production conditions. Across the full laying cycle, the flock performance not only met but consistently exceeded the standard, highlighting the excellent genetic potential and adaptability of this variety. All figures presented are based exclusively on non-cage flocks. All evaluated flocks were hatched after 1 August 2024, representing the latest figures currently available in Norway. The results reflect the performance observed within the evaluated production period. The production curve shows a strong and fast production start, followed by excellent persistency at a very high level. Even in later stages of the cycle, lay performance remained stable, supporting sustained egg output and long productive lifetimes. 
Egg weight development was highly consistent and closely aligned with the standard, providing reliability for grading and market requirements.
This stability is a key advantage for producers seeking predictable performance and steady product quality over time.
In addition, excellent liveability throughout the entire cycle underscores the robustness of LOHMANN LSL-LITE. Low losses and stable health performance confirm the breed’s suitability for a wide range of different commercial environments and contribute directly to economic efficiency.
The most convincing indicator of overall performance is the cumulative egg output.
With 378.6 eggs per hen housed at 78 weeks, the actual results exceeded the standard by almost 9 additional eggs per hen in the desired eggweight range, delivering a clear economic benefit for producers. Reliability must come along with repeatibility and this is what these figures show, since this is the final results of not only one flock, but from 65 independent flocks in several different locations and housings.

 

Norway has just started the transition to prolonged production cycles from 78 weeks in the past.
As performance trends indicate continued persistency, we expect that a total production of more than 500 eggs per hen housed at 100 weeks will be easily achieved.
